MySQL database backend for request-tracker5
Request Tracker (RT) is a ticketing system which enables a group of people to intelligently and efficiently manage tasks, issues, and requests submitted by a community of users. It features web, email, and command-line interfaces (see the package rt5-clients).
RT manages key tasks such as the identification, prioritization, assignment, resolution, and notification required by enterprise-critical applications, including project management, help desk, NOC ticketing, CRM, and software development.
This package provides the 5 series of RT. It can be installed alongside the 3.8 and 4 series without any problems.
This empty package provides dependencies and dbconfig-common support for using Request Tracker version 5 with a MySQL database.
